How can I get more information?

The Building department provides various handouts on permit application procedures and requirements.  This information is available on the City of West Fargo Website or at the West Fargo Building department office located at West Fargo City Hall (800 4th Avenue East Suite 1, West Fargo) between 8 a.m. and 5 p.m. Monday through Friday.
